2

Remote Computer Science Student Jobs in West Virginia

$58.25 - $76.75/hr

S. degree in Computer Science, Systems Engineering, or a related discipline * 8+ years of ... Flexible work environment, ability to work remote, hybrid or in-office * Flexible time off ...

Bachelor's degree in a Business field of study or Computer Science (MBA / Master's degree in ... Flexible work environment, ability to work remote, hybrid or in-office. * Flexible time off ...

S. of Computer Science, Software Engineering, B.A. of Healthcare Administration, or related degree) or equivalent experience * Able to travel throughout sales territory - (50-75%) Additional ...

Software Engineer III - UPDATED

Green Bank, WV · On-site +1

$46.75 - $63/hr

For well qualified candidates, a remote work arrangement may be considered. What You Will be Doing ... You have a bachelor's degree in Computer Science, Physics, Engineering, Applied Mathematics, or ...

Software Engineer III - UPDATED

Green Bank, WV · On-site +1

$46.75 - $63/hr

For well qualified candidates, a remote work arrangement may be considered. What You Will be Doing ... You have a bachelor's degree in Computer Science, Physics, Engineering, Applied Mathematics, or ...

S. degree in Computer Science, Software Engineering, or a related technical discipline * 8+ years ... Flexible work environment, ability to work remote, hybrid or in-office * Flexible time off ...

Senior Data Platform Engineer, Remote

Charleston, WV · On-site +1

$98K - $133K/yr

Bachelor's degree in computer science, Information Systems, or a related field, or equivalent ... Flexible work environment, ability to work remote, hybrid or in-office * Flexible time off ...

next page

Showing results 1-20

Remote Computer Science Student information

What is a remote computer science student?

A remote computer science student is someone who is studying computer science online, rather than attending classes in person. This allows them to access coursework, lectures, and assignments through digital platforms from anywhere with an internet connection. Remote students often interact with professors and classmates via email, discussion boards, or video calls. This flexible learning format can be beneficial for those balancing other commitments or living far from campus.

What is the difference between Remote Computer Science Student vs Remote Software Developer?

AspectRemote Computer Science StudentRemote Software Developer
Required CredentialsEnrolled in a computer science program, often no professional certifications neededTypically holds a degree or certification in software development or related field
Work EnvironmentPart-time or internship roles, flexible hours, learning-focusedFull-time or project-based, professional work environment
Employer & Industry UsageEducational institutions, internships, entry-level projectsTech companies, startups, freelance projects
Search & Comparison IntentLooking for learning opportunities, internships, or entry-level rolesSeeking professional remote software development jobs

The main difference between a Remote Computer Science Student and a Remote Software Developer lies in their experience and employment status. Students focus on learning and internships, often without professional certifications, while software developers are experienced professionals working on projects. Both roles may work remotely, but their responsibilities and career stages differ.

What are some effective strategies for staying engaged and productive as a remote computer science student?

As a remote computer science student, maintaining engagement and productivity can be challenging due to fewer in-person interactions and the need for self-discipline. Setting a structured daily schedule, actively participating in virtual discussions, and regularly collaborating with peers on group projects can help. Utilizing online resources, seeking feedback from instructors, and joining virtual study groups are also effective ways to stay connected and motivated. It's important to create a dedicated workspace and set clear goals to manage your time efficiently and avoid distractions.

What are the key skills and qualifications needed to thrive as a Remote Computer Science Student, and why are they important?

To thrive as a Remote Computer Science Student, you need a solid understanding of programming fundamentals, algorithms, and data structures, typically supported by enrollment in a computer science degree program. Familiarity with coding platforms (like GitHub), learning management systems (such as Canvas or Blackboard), and collaboration tools (like Zoom and Slack) is common. Self-motivation, time management, and strong written communication skills are essential soft skills for remote study success. These competencies ensure effective learning, collaboration, and progress in a virtual academic environment.
What are the most commonly searched types of Computer Science Student jobs in West Virginia? The most popular types of Computer Science Student jobs in West Virginia are:
What are popular job titles related to Remote Computer Science Student jobs in West Virginia? For Remote Computer Science Student jobs in West Virginia, the most frequently searched job titles are:
What job categories do people searching Remote Computer Science Student jobs in West Virginia look for? The top searched job categories for Remote Computer Science Student jobs in West Virginia are:
What cities in West Virginia are hiring for Remote Computer Science Student jobs? Cities in West Virginia with the most Remote Computer Science Student job openings:
Infographic showing various Remote Computer Science Student job openings in West Virginia as of May 2026, with employment types broken down into 4% Internship, 49% Full Time, 42% Part Time, and 5% Contract. Highlights an 100% Remote job distribution.

$58.25 - $76.75/hr

Full-time

Medical, Dental, Vision, Life, Retirement, PTO

Posted 7 days ago


Job description

Company Description

Experian is a global data and technology company, powering opportunities for people and businesses around the world. We operate across a range of markets, from financial services to healthcare, automotive, agribusiness, insurance, and many more. Experian invests in people and new advanced technologies to unlock the power of data. We have an amazing team of 25,200 people in 32 countries.

Job Description

Overview

We are looking for a Staff Software Architect to lead the technical vision and architectural strategy for our cloud-native platform and agentic AI capabilities. You will help shape how our systems are designed and evolved at scale. You will also promote infrastructure excellence across the organization, driving their design, deployment, and evolution at scale. You will report to the Sr. Principal Engineer

Responsibilities:

  • Manage and evolve the end-to-end architectural blueprint for cloud-native applications at scale - covering compute, data, networking, security, and observability layers on AWS.
  • Define and promote agentic AI architecture patterns, including multi-agent systems, tool orchestration, memory and retrieval strategies, LLM routing, guardrails, and feedback loops. Translate these patterns into relevant standards and reusable reference architectures.
  • Establish and govern DevOps standards across the organization: CI/CD pipeline design, GitOps practices, deployment strategies (blue/green, canary, progressive delivery), environment parity, and release engineering.
  • Design and oversee platform infrastructure. This includes ECS, Kubernetes clusters (EKS), service mesh, API gateway strategy, secrets management, IAM/RBAC governance, and data stores like DynamoDB, Aurora RDS, Postgres, Elastic/OpenSearch. Additionally, it involves multi-account/multi-region AWS topology.
  • Lead architecture reviews and provide binding technical decisions on high-risk changes - balancing velocity, reliability, cost, and security.
  • Define SLOs/SLIs/error budgets, logging standards, distributed tracing, capacity planning, and incident response frameworks.
  • Introduce new technologies through structured PoC and risk assessment processes; build internal communities of practice around architectural patterns.
  • Produce architecture decision records (ADRs), system context diagrams, threat models, and runbooks that serve as the source of truth for platform design.
  • Be a technical advisor to Product and Partners - translating architectural constraints and capabilities into clear strategic options.
  • Mentor staff and senior engineers on architectural thinking, systems design, and engineering leadership; conduct design reviews that raise the technical bar across teams.
Qualifications
  • B.S. or M.S. degree in Computer Science, Systems Engineering, or a related discipline
  • 8+ years of experience in software engineering and systems architecture, with 3+ years in a dedicated architect or principal engineer role.
  • 5+ years of AWS architecture experience at scale - including multi-account organization design, landing zone/Control Tower, VPC design, IAM governance, and cost optimization
  • Experience architecting distributed systems and services that sustain high availability (99.99%), low latency, and elastic scalability under variable production load.
  • Experience designing agentic AI architectures: orchestration layers, agent frameworks (LangGraph, AutoGen, Semantic Kernel, or equivalent), tool/API integration, evaluation pipelines, and operational monitoring of AI systems.
  • DevOps and platform engineering expertise: Kubernetes (EKS), Terraform/CDK, Helm, ArgoCD/Flux (GitOps), GitHub Actions/Jenkins/Harness CI/CD, and container security practices.
  • Background in API gateway patterns (REST, gRPC, async event-driven).
  • Experience establishing SRE practices including SLO definition, error budgets, runbooks, chaos engineering, and game days.
  • Grasp of cloud security architecture: zero-trust networking, secrets management (Vault, AWS Secrets Manager), SIEM integration, and compliance frameworks (SOC 2, ISO 27001)
  • Experience working across data architecture concerns: streaming pipelines (Kafka, Kinesis), data lakes, OLAP/OLTP boundary design, and caching strategies (ElastiCache, Redis).
  • Experience presenting architecture artifacts - C4 diagrams, sequence diagrams, threat models, ADRs
  • Experience scaling engineering organizations through architecture standards, platform investment, and internal developer experience improvements.
  • #LI-Remote
Additional Information

Benefits/Perks

  • Great compensation package and bonus plan
  • Core benefits including medical, dental, vision, and matching 401K
  • Flexible work environment, ability to work remote, hybrid or in-office
  • Flexible time off including volunteer time off, vacation, sick and 12-paid holidays
  • Explore all our exciting benefits here: https://yourexperianbenefits.com/cand-index.html

Our uniqueness is that we celebrate yours. Experian's people first, inclusive and purpose driven culture is multi award-winning; World's Best Workplaces 2025 (Fortune Global Top 25), Great Place To Work in 26 countries to name a few. Check out Experian Life on social or explore our Careers Site to understand why.

Our compensation reflects the cost of labor across several U.S. geographic markets. The base pay range for this position is listed above. Within this range, individual pay is determined by work location and additional factors such as job-related skills, experience, and education. This position is also eligible for a variable pay opportunity and a comprehensive benefits package.

Experian is proud to be an Equal Opportunity Employer for all groups protected under applicable federal, state and local law, including protected veterans and individuals with disabilities. If you have a disability or special need that requires accommodation, please let us know at the earliest opportunity.